Hey all,

Just got this loverly monitor. Just need to ask something though. When I maximise a window, say IE, the screen starts to make a buzzing noise. However if a minimise a window and return to desktop it stops.

Anyone with this monitor have the same thing?

Cheers
 
never heard of that on any monitor tbh! make sure you're running at 60Hz refresh rate maybe....also try VGA and DVI and see if it does it on both?
 
HI there

Try using a different power lead.

If it still does it then try plugging in the monitor elsewhere or if possibly connect the monitor onto a UPS/Surge protector to rule out any possibilities there.

Other alternative is just leave the panel on for a good 48 hours just in case its settling in, like a running in period kind of thing.
 
Tried that Gibbo, no luck :(

I've maximised Outlook Express and it doesn't do it, but when I do the same in Internet Explorer it starts buzzing. I can't figure it out. Why should different applications make a difference.
 
I've had issues like this before with video cards but not with a monitor. Quite a few video cards I've had would buzz when there were certain colours on screen, lots of white seemed especially bad. My 8800 does it too. I suppose it could be a similar issue.
